✈️ The Sukhoi Su-57, Russia's 5th-generation twin-engine stealth multirole fighter, is now equipped with a groundbreaking Stage 2 engine, which enhances its combat capabilities, the Rostec State Corporation announced.

"The Su-57 platform is evolving. Its combat capabilities are expanding, incorporating the latest technologies. In other words, its effectiveness continues to grow," the Rostec’s press service said.


Adaptable with both first and second stage engines, the Su-57 remains a force with stealth, internal weapon capacity, supersonic speed, and high maneuverability.

76 Su-57s are scheduled for delivery to the Russian Aerospace Forces by 2027, six are already in service, and 22 more are expected by the end of 2024.

Over 4,600 children have now been reportedly killed and over 8,600 injured with more than 1,500 reported missing or presumed to be under the rubble in Gaza, UNICEF Middle East and North Africa Regional Office told Sputnik.

"Over 1.5 million people are displaced, an estimated half of whom are children, many of whom are now living in densely populated shelters with little access to safe water, food and sanitation. Safe water is running out in the Gaza Strip, posing particularly lethal risks for children. People are being forced to use dirty water from wells, seawater and other unsafe sources, drastically increasing risks for diarrheal disease, pausing a great risk especially to children under five."


UNICEF states that it is offering humanitarian assistance through the Rafah border. This assistance includes items such as water, water purification materials, health equipment, medicines, hygiene kits, and humanitarian cash assistance.

📸 Esthetics of flamethrower training

Flamethrower units of the Russian Army conducted exercises near St. Petersburg.

The RPO-A "Shmel" is a disposable rocket-propelled flamethrower which has an effective firing range from 20-1000 m (sighting range is 600 m). The RPO-A has a thermobaric warhead and is designed for attacking soft targets under moderate cover.

🇷🇴 Training Ukrainians or poking the Russian Bear: Why did NATO set up new F-16 training base in Romania?

The Romanian Air Force, in coordination with the Dutch military, Denmark, and US weapons-making giant Lockheed Martin, has established a new training base in Romania’s southeast, ostensibly to train NATO and Ukrainian pilots to operate F-16 fighter jets. Along with poking the Russian bear, the base will free up the alliance’s hands to conduct training operations it can’t do in wealthier Western European countries, says retired US Air Force Lieutenant-Colonel and former Pentagon analyst Karen Kwiatkowski.

“As Western Europe has increasingly restricted both air and ground NATO training, NATO and the US have sought to use the newer NATO countries, which are poorer, less populated, and have a less robust regulatory structure relating to noise, air and chemical pollution, as a place to train and operation,” Kwiatkowski said.
